Around the world, the production and use of nanomaterials, as well as carcinogenic, mutagenic, reprotoxic substances (CMR) and endocrine disruptors has systematically increased. The increase in production has exposed workers to hazardous substances in practically all branches of the world economy. Readers will have access to up-to-date and comprehensive knowledge on emerging risks related to nanomaterials, endocrine disruptors, reprotoxic, carcinogenic and mutagenic substances, which are related to the development of technologies and workplaces. The book will provide the tools for occupational risk assessment of chemical substances for which there are no safety levels of exposure as well as an indication of methods and measurements to protect human health and reduce chemical risks at the workplace. This book creates awareness for employers, employees and safety experts about emerging risks related to chemical agents resulting in the reduction of cancer, reproductive system diseases, cases of abnormal child development, hormonal system disorders leading to abnormal metabolism, obesity, and diabetes.

Malgorzata Posniak, PhD is head of the Department of Chemical, Aerosol and Biological Hazards in the Central Institute for Labour Protection – National Research Institute. She graduated from the Faculty of Pharmacy, specializing in pharmaceutical technology at the Medical University of Warsaw. She is an expert of Polish Interdepartmental Commission for MAC and MAI Values, an expert of Group for Chemical Agents, editor of “Principles and Methods of Assessing the Working Environment” and associated editor of International Journal of Occupational Safety. She is also a member of the Chromatographic Analysis Commission of the Polish Academy of Sciences and an expert of chemical agents in European Agency for Safety and Health at Work.
